Billiard Room With Your Existing Business MANY Hairdressers, Tobacconists and-Storekeepers : havV I considerably augmented their Income by installing a Billiard Table or two. You can be equally successful. If your location in Town, Suburbs, or Country is good enough for any ordinary business it should also prove suitable for a ■ Billiard Saloon. Consult Alcock's. They will advise you .! ■ - Alcock's supply the Finest of Billiard j Tables and'all Accessories to the game. Easy Terras, if desired. A well-equipped room can be opened on a surprisingly moderate cash out- . lay. Cost of upkeep is trifling.'A small | saloon, requires little'' 'supervision. . i Revenue is steady and substantial. . | Billiards is' an all-the-year-round game. The Billiard Season never ends.
